2024 GS-14 Pay in Omaha
GS-14 employees with a duty station in Omaha-Council Bluffs-Fremont, NE-IA earn 17.94% on top of the base GS-14 pay scale. That means a GS-14 Step 1 salary jumps from $104,604 on the base table to $123,370 in Omaha.
2024 GS-14 Pay in Omaha
Locality-adjusted GS-14 rates for Omaha-Council Bluffs-Fremont, NE-IA.
| Step | Annual salary | Biweekly pay | Hourly rate | Locality add-on |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Step 1 | $123,370 | $4,745.00 | $59.11 | +$18,766 |
| Step 2 | $127,483 | $4,903.19 | $61.08 | +$19,392 |
| Step 3 | $131,595 | $5,061.35 | $63.05 | +$20,017 |
| Step 4 | $135,708 | $5,219.54 | $65.03 | +$20,643 |
| Step 5 | $139,820 | $5,377.69 | $67.00 | +$21,268 |
| Step 6 | $143,933 | $5,535.88 | $68.97 | +$21,894 |
| Step 7 | $148,045 | $5,694.04 | $70.94 | +$22,519 |
| Step 8 | $152,158 | $5,852.23 | $72.91 | +$23,145 |
| Step 9 | $156,271 | $6,010.42 | $74.88 | +$23,771 |
| Step 10 | $160,383 | $6,168.58 | $76.85 | +$24,396 |

GS-14 in Omaha: what to expect
Supervisory managers, senior program leads and senior technical experts. Many agency branch chiefs sit at GS-14.
For 2024, the Omaha pay area adds a 17.94% locality adjustment on top of the nationwide base GS schedule. Every GS-14 employee assigned to this area benefits from that same percentage, regardless of step or series.
Qualifications and career path
Minimum qualifications. One year of specialized experience at the GS-13 level.
Promotion path. Competitive promotion to GS-15 is selective; many GS-14 employees reach this grade as a career peak.
The rough military equivalent for GS-14 is O-6 Colonel, useful for comparing GS roles against enlisted and officer ranks when looking at pay or authority level.
Biweekly take-home for GS-14 in Omaha
Before taxes and deductions, a GS-14 Step 1 employee in Omaha earns roughly $4,745 per biweekly pay period. At Step 10 that rises to $6,169. Actual take-home will be lower after federal tax, state tax, TSP contributions, retirement and health insurance deductions.

How much does a GS-14 make in Omaha?
In 2024, a GS-14 Step 1 employee in Omaha earns $123,370 per year. At Step 10 the salary reaches $160,383. This is 17.94% higher than the base GS-14 salary. -
What is the locality adjustment for GS-14 in Omaha?
The locality adjustment is the same for every grade and step within a pay area. For Omaha in 2024, it is 17.94%. On a GS-14 Step 1 salary that translates to an extra $18,766 per year. -
What is the biweekly pay for GS-14 in Omaha?
Biweekly pay is annual salary divided by 26. A GS-14 Step 1 employee in Omaha earns roughly $4,745 per pay period before tax and retirement deductions.
